Transaction 8a23b3c2120a34d18acf7725fefe13eb17d32dd2a75ee35373ba885eb3eab491
3 Input
2 Outputs
- 8a23b3c2120a34d18acf7725fefe13eb17d32dd2a75ee35373ba885eb3eab491:0
- 8a23b3c2120a34d18acf7725fefe13eb17d32dd2a75ee35373ba885eb3eab491:1
value 2475285
address 18VXjSiyeMLH3TZc4AwgcentGNiyMQ7mZj
value 895099
address 197SSFhW4rFad2Hb5HhRWHrRoyad71rZJA